Fun atmosphere, but like every indoor café in Cedar Point, there is never enough room inside for people to sit comfortably.
There is seating outside that is usually available on slow attendance days, but usually directly in sunlight.

Food is decent, diner style food, fries, burgers, milkshakes, etc. Prices are reasonable enough for where you're at.
